C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card Review
Pros
- Earn up to 1.5 Aeroplan points per $1 spent on eligible purchases
- Comprehensive travel and purchase insurance coverage
- Access to airport lounges and Priority Pass membership
- Earn 5,000 Aeroplan points for each additional authorized user
- Enjoy Air Canada travel benefits, such as priority boarding and free checked bags
- Access to Visa Infinite Privilege Concierge
Cons
- High annual fee of $599
- Minimum annual income requirement of $150,000 (individual) or $200,000 (household)
- Lesser rewards on everyday spending, only 1.25 points per $1 on eligible purchases
- Limited benefits for those who do not frequently travel with Air Canada

Calculating your annual rewards
We estimate that spending $2,000 per month with the C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card would earn $678 in rewards over the year.
Our performance testing research uses an accurate estimation of the average Canadian households spending patterns to predict the rewards a card will earn.
We found that you’d earn this per category:
Gas | $72 |
Groceries | $180 |
Restaurants | $72 |
Specific Stores | $48 |
Travel | $36 |
All Other Spend | $270 |
Our study investigating the value found that each dollar spent on the C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card is worth up to $0.02, depending on how you redeem.
This $678 in rewards value puts the C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card in the top 10% of credit cards in Canada based on rewards earned.
The average credit card in our database earns $337 in rewards for the same spend that the C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card earns $678 in rewards value.
We can compare this card to other options by looking at the earn rate by category.
This earn rate is the percentage return that you would get when you spend on this card, assuming you redeem at the predicted maximum value.
For example, if a card earned 5 points per dollar on gas and each point is worth up to $0.02, then the earn rate is 5 points multiplied by $0.02 each, divided by the dollar you spent.
In this example, that’s a 10% earn rate on gas.

For an annual spend of $24,000, we estimated annual rewards value at up to $678.
That’s equivalent to a 2.83% return on spending.
The C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card has an annual fee of $599. After deducting this, we predicted net annual rewards of $79.
This puts it in the bottom 30% of credit cards for net rewards after fees.
In comparison, the average card earns net annual rewards of $254.
Fees
The C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card has a $599 annual fee.
The average card charges $85. So, the C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card is in the top 10% of cards based on the cost of the annual fee.

Interest Rates
Purchase | 20.99% |
Cash Advance | 22.99% |
Balance Transfer | 22.99% |
The average (median) credit card has a purchase interest rate of 19.99% and so the C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card charges 1% more than the average.
For cash advances it costs 22.99% compared to the average of 19.96%.

Insurance coverage
Insurance | This Card | Average |
---|---|---|
Extended Warranty | 2 years | 1 year |
Purchase Protection | 180 days | 90 days |
Travel Accident | $500,000 | $500,000 |
Emergency Medical Term | 31 days | 15 days |
Emergency Medical over 65 | 10 days | 4 days |
Trip Cancellation | $2,500 | $1,500 |
Trip Interruption | $5,000 | $2,000 |
Flight Delay | $500 | $500 |
Baggage Delay | $500 | $500 |
Lost or Stolen Baggage | $1,000 | $1,000 |
Rental Car Theft & Damage | Yes | No |
Hotel Burglary | $2,500 | $1,000 |
Mobile Phone Insurance | $1,500 | $1,000 |
We scored it 4.2 out of 5 for insurance.
It offers 13 types of insurance, whereas the average card has 5 types of coverage.
Approval and qualifying
Do I qualify? | |
---|---|
Estimated Credit Score | 760 – 900 |
Personal Income | $150,000 |
Household Income | $200,000 |
Fees | |
---|---|
Annual Fee | $599 |
Extra Card Fee | $0 |
Card type | Visa |
We scored it 2.5 out of 5 for approval.
We predict that you will require a credit score of at least 760 to qualify for the C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card, while the average card requires 652 to qualify.
This puts it in the top top 10% of cards by approval difficulty.
The personal income requirements are $150,000, while the average card requires $23,896.
This puts it in the top 10% of cards by the income required to qualify.
The C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card is designed to reward cardholders with Aeroplan points, providing a strong choice for frequent travellers looking to capitalize on travel rewards. We will delve into its earning potential, key benefits and drawbacks, and other relevant information to help you decide if this credit card is the right fit for you.
Earning potential
The C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card earns Aeroplan points primarily on everyday purchases. The reward rates for different spending categories are as follows:
- 1.5 points for every $1 spent on gas, grocery, and drugstore purchases
- 1.25 points for every $1 spent on dining and food delivery purchases
- 1.25 points for every $1 spent on travel purchased through Air Canada
- 1 point for every $1 spent on all other purchases
Benefits
- Travel Perks & Insurance: As a cardholder, you will receive numerous travel perks such as priority boarding, priority check-in, and access to Air Canada Maple Leaf lounges. Additionally, this card offers comprehensive travel insurance coverage including emergency medical, trip cancellation/interruption, flight delay, and baggage loss/delay insurance.
- Welcome Bonus & Annual Fee Rebate: New cardholders can take advantage of a generous welcome bonus of up to 50,000 Aeroplan points after meeting the minimum spend requirement.
Furthermore, enjoy a $200 annual statement credit for Air Canada travel purchases and a first-year annual fee rebate for both the primary and additional cardholders (a total savings of up to $599). - Global Airport Lounge Access The C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card provides complimentary Priority Pass membership, giving you access to over 1,300 airport lounges worldwide along with six complimentary lounge visits per year.
- Concierge Service & Mobile Device Insurance This premium credit card comes with a dedicated concierge service to assist with travel arrangements, event bookings, and more. Additionally, cardholders receive mobile device insurance for up to $1,000 in case of loss or damage to their smartphones or tablets.
Drawbacks
- High Annual Fee A significant drawback of this card is the high annual fee of $599, which may deter potential users. However, with the first-year fee rebate and valuable benefits offered, it could still be an attractive option for heavy spenders and frequent travellers.
- Ideal for Frequent Travellers Another drawback is that this card targets frequent travellers, particularly those loyal to Air Canada. Those who do not travel often may not benefit fully from the rewards and perks that the card offers.
Additional information:
Cardholders enrolled in the CIBC Aeroplan Visa Infinite Privilege Card are also provided with purchase protection and extended warranty on eligible items. It is important to consider your personal spending habits and travel preferences before opting for this card, as its full potential can be unlocked with frequent usage and travel-related spending.
